Welders should wear protecting gear, including a mask, gloves and flame-resistant clothing to forestall eye damage and burns. DC welders are often costlier however have a wider selection of out there electrodes for the Stick (SMAW) course of and simpler arc putting, and improved penetration and course of control.

Dearer welders have longer responsibility cycles, and some can run even repeatedly at a 100% obligation cycle. Longer duty cycles are useful when welding thicker materials; however, home and hobby welders, might discover duty cycles less necessary than professional welding retailers. Conventional welders are easier and sturdier in construction and would possibly show more reliable in the long term.

MIG welding is the main sort of welding that is suitable for a wide range of positions however it truly relies on upon the welder how he sets the welding protest and be in an agreeable position to do the welding methodology. An open to welding position is the best approach to get a clean weld.

The length of welding terminal is likewise critical. On the off chance that the wire stick-out is too long, it will upset the protecting gas from spreading just as over the metal surface. The stream of gas additionally needs to be directed and it must be in equalization with the stick out. An excess of or too less gas, both will influence the welding procedure. It is for the most part educated to keep the length with respect to stand out at 3/fourth of an inch and discover a decent adjust of gas stream with this length, as indicated by the circumstances.
